## Environment Variables: Calendar Sync

Reviewer note: the Tidemark calendar sync occasionally double-books when the upstream Hollowpine feed and our local store disagree on event ownership. Conflict resolution is controlled by the sync worker's env file, and the worker also needs a signing secret to call Hollowpine. That secret belongs on the very next line:

sealed setting: COURIER_KEY29=170ad45524657711572101e080d15

### Step 4: Enable the audit-log viewer

After migrating to Corvane 3.x, the legacy log browser is removed and the new audit-log viewer takes over. It reads directly from the append-only event store, so no separate export job is needed. Access is gated by the `audit.read` role; verify this mapping before granting reviewer accounts. Retention and redaction behavior are controlled entirely by the viewer's service config. Confirm that your deployment matches the following configuration before sign-off.

deployment values, kajep-kageg:
[praix]
host = praix.paliqcorp.corp
user = praix_svc
database = praix_prod

Q: How do I unlock the Snipresize batch queue after a failed run?

A: Happens a lot, honestly. Run `snipresize queue --inspect` first to see which shard stalled — usually it's the thumbnail pass choking on a corrupt source file. Drop the bad file, rerun with `--resume`. If the queue stays locked, the CLI asks for the vault recovery passphrase before it'll clear state. Per Halloway's note from last sync, that passphrase is:

vault phrase of bagaf-kajeg = jorath-feniel-briir-siliel-ralix